The IF Statement Tableau returns the result (i.e. TRUE) only if … WebSep 5, 2024 · Tableau Desktop Answer In general the formula to count dimension members that meet a condition is: { FIXED [Dimension] : SUM ( IF THEN 1 ELSE 0 END ) } There are several use cases that may use this general formula.
